枫叶
Stack&Positioned Stack&Positioned
层叠布局层叠布局和Web中的绝对定位、Android中的Frame布局是相似的,子widget可以根据到父容器四个角的位置来确定本身的位置。绝对定位允许子widget堆叠(按照代码中声明的顺序)。Flutter中使用Stack和Positi
2019-02-26
Flex&Expand Flex&Expand
FlexFlex可以沿着水平或垂直方向排列子widget,如果你知道主轴方向,使用Row或Column会方便一些,因为Row和Column都继承自Flex,参数基本相同,所以能使用Flex的地方一定可以使用Row或Column。Flex本身
2019-02-26
Wrap&Flow Wrap&Flow
Wrap在介绍Row和Colum时,如果子widget超出屏幕范围,则会报溢出错误,如: Row( children: <Widget>[ Text("xxx"*100) ], ); 可以看到,右边溢出部分报错。这是
2019-02-26
Button Button
介绍 在Material Widget 库中提供了多种按钮Widget,如RaisedButton、FlatButton、OutlineButton等。 所有Material库中的按钮都具备以下共同点: 按下时会有“水波动画”。 有一个
2019-02-26
Row&Colum Row&Colum
介绍 沿着水平或垂直方向排列Widget。 Column&Row 垂直和水平线性布局 Column({ Key key, MainAxisAlignment mainAxisAlignment = MainAxi
2019-02-26
Text Text
1. 介绍 Text用于显示简单样式文本,它包含一些控制文本显示样式的一些属性。 类结构 属性data 显示的文本 style 字体样式 属性值 意义 inherit 是否继承 color 字体颜色 fontSiz
2019-02-26
StatefulWidget和StatelessWidget StatefulWidget和StatelessWidget
介绍Flutter提供了一套丰富、强大的基础widget,在基础widget库之上Flutter又提供了一套Material风格(Android默认的视觉风格)和一套Cupertino风格(iOS视觉风格)的widget库。要使用基础wid
2019-02-26
Image&Icon Image&Icon
Flutter 可以使用Image加载显示asset、本地、内存以及网络图片 ImageProvider 是一个抽象类,定义了图片数据获取的接口load(),不同的数据源由对应不同的ImageProvider,如AssertImage、
2019-02-26
PopupMenu PopupMenu
介绍 弹出式菜单 示例import 'package:flutter/material.dart'; class PopupMenuMaterial extends StatefulWidget { @override Stat
2019-02-25
BottomNavigationBar BottomNavigationBar
介绍 底部导航是常见的APP布局方式,实际上我自己常用的app都是底部导航的 ##相关属性 BottomNavigationBar 属性 说明 items BottomNavigationBarItem 列表,包含了导航栏中的按
2019-02-25
2 / 6